Panama Canal 2022 Trip Report P8

The problem with the toilet.
While the room itself for the toilet was nice, the shower was spacious, tall and the vanity was nice with plenty of space.
The Loo was the issue.
The loo was a circular round thing that "floated" (being held from the back). The circle itself being VERY thin and uncomfortable.
To make things worse, the loo seat was strangely more elevated than the other public loos on the ship which made me facepalm.

Ours was the opposite, left side was the loo, right side was the shower.

The good was, we were almost in the front of the ship so a tiny walk and we were right on the elevators straight to the main theatre and access to some of the main bars on the top floor.

We walked around 20-30 meters and we arrived to the center, where the ships's main hall is with guest services and on top is the irish "pub" that functions as 24/7 restaurant.

It also worked as Sports bar, because it had quite a few of screens. Very good as the World Cup was starting exactly mid cruise.

Dinner on the main restaurant called AZURA was very good. There were the classics sans the scargots :(
But the menu rotation was very good in my opinion.

20221124_201030.jpg

You could of course, dress a bit better and get to the Tsar's palace, which was a bit more fancy and had some uptiered dishes also included in the cruise ship.

We were not a fan of the ships's buffette. Feel way too small for the number of people on board and it seems everyone wanted to try the buffet. So trying to find room to sit down was a huge shore most of the time.

As for the beds, they were very comfortable.
Only issue for us is that the water limitation. They only gave us 2 tiny bottles, 2 tiny glasses and we had a dry mouth halfway the night.
( I ended buying some sealed rehusable water bottles to refill on the next days).
Not to mention that I had to climb to the restroom (something that gave us a few laughs).

The internet was decent on the first day, but the farther we strayed from Panama the worse the speeds became.. going as slow as 128Kb/s (yep, thats almost dial up speed) with tons of proxy and security errors (probably to block streaming services..etc.. which are forced on much more expensive packages).

Our first day of port was Cartagena de Indias.
Where we had a Tour already lined up to meet most of the city.
Many of our friends have said amazing things of Cartagena, so our expectations where quite high.

The debark process was very simple. Get to Deck 4 forward, show your card and done.. you're out.

We just had to wait a few from the cruise area to the border of the port where the "touristic welcome center" started. Where our first tour contact was.

He welcomed us and gave us a basic spiel before meeting going around the welcome center, into the parking lot. To board the small minivan that had both our driver AND the guide.
